
Brown Soda Bread with Bran

Brown soda bread with bran
Ingredients
- Wheat Flour 1¾ cups
- Coarsely Ground Rye Flour 1¾ cups
- Bran to taste
- Peanut Sprouts 3 tablespoons
- Brown Sugar 2 tablespoons
- Ground Oats 2 tablespoons
- Salt ½ teaspoon
- Butter 2 tablespoons
- Activated Baking Soda 1 teaspoon
- Buttermilk 2 cups
Step-by-Step Guide
Step 1
Preheat the oven to 430°F. Grease a loaf pan with butter.
Step 2
In a large bowl, mix together the wheat flour, coarse flour, bran, wheat sprouts, oats, brown sugar, baking soda, and salt. Mix well and add the butter cut into small pieces. Knead by hand until the dough resembles crumbs.
Step 3
Then add the buttermilk and knead the dough well, transfer it to the prepared pan, and bake until done, checking with a wooden stick, for about 40 minutes.
Step 4
Turn the bread out onto a plate and let it cool.
